Patent · US Active

Paging enablement of storage translation metadata

US9798673B2 · kind B2 · utility

6Cited by
2References
24Claims
0Family size

Assignee

Inventors

Key dates

Filing dateMar 14, 2013
Grant dateOct 24, 2017
Priority date
Expiry dateApr 22, 2033

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2212/2022
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

Techniques are disclosed relating to storing translations in memory that are usable to access data on a recording medium. In one embodiment, a request is sent for a memory allocation within a non-pageable portion of a memory in a computer system. Responsive to the request, allocated memory is received. Translations usable to map logical addresses to physical addresses within a storage device are stored within the allocated memory. In some embodiments, the translations are usable to access an area within the storage device used to store pages evicted from the memory. In one embodiment, a size of the memory allocation is determined based on a size of the area. In another embodiment, a size of the memory allocation is determined based on a size of a partition including the area. In some embodiments, the storage device is a solid-state storage array.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.